Global Uv Disinfection Systems Market (USD Million), 2021 - 2031

In the year 2024, the Global Uv Disinfection Systems Market was valued at USD 2208.73 million. The size of this market is expected to increase to USD 4304.20 million by the year 2031, while growing at a Compounded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 10.0%.
